Joseph Dadounes sound work, Universes, sets out to form an alternative musical space attesting to his rejection of the crude classification of various musical styles. Dadoune incorporating in his work excerpts of classical music and polyphonic Mediterranean singing. He frequently employs vinyl records, moving the record slowly to distort the sound and generate an archaic, blurred, deep sound. Dadounes work may be construed as representing a political stand, as it reflects a quasi-Western setting, albeit Universes is not necessarily such. Despite its elusive title, the work does not really fall into the category of world music.
